Calculating break-even and graphing. San Juan Health Department's dental clinic projects the following costs and rates for the year 20XX.

Total fixed costs $175,000

Variable costs $48 per patient

Charges $150 per patient

A. Using this information, determine the break even point in patients.

B. Using this information, determine the break-even point in dollars.

C. Graph this scenario in a break-even chart using a range of 0 to 3,500 patients in 500-patient increments.

D. If the clinic decides it would like to make a profit of $5,500, what is the new break-even point in patients?

E. If the clinic decides it would like to make a profit of $5,500 at 1,770 patients, what is the new break-even point in dollars?

Explanation / Answer

Contribution per patient = 150 - 48 = 102

CM ratio = 102 /150 = .68 or68%

A)BEP($) =Fixed cost /CM ratio

              = 175,000 / .68 =$ 257,352.94

B)BEP(units) = 175000/ 102 = 1715.69    units [rounded to 1716 ]

D) BEP = (175000 +5500) / 102

            = 180500/ 102

           = 1770 patients (rounded)

E) BEP dollars = 1770 * 150 = $ 265500
